终极解决方案:Navicat Premium for Mac 许可证无限重置教程
【免费下载链接】navicat_reset_macnavicat16 mac版无限重置试用期脚本项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ac
还在为Navicat Premium试用期到期而烦恼吗?这款广受欢迎的数据库管理工具提供了强大的功能,但试用期限制常常让开发者头疼。本文将为你详细介绍如何在macOS系统上无限重置Navicat Premium的试用期,让你持续享受这款专业工具带来的便利。
🔍 核心重置原理深度解析
Navicat Premium在macOS系统中通过特定文件存储许可证验证信息,重置的关键在于删除这些验证数据。主要涉及两个核心文件:
配置文件操作
Navicat会在~/Library/Preferences/com.navicat.NavicatPremium.plis文件中存储32位哈希格式的顶级键数据,这些就是许可证验证的关键信息。通过删除这些特定的key值,可以让软件重新进入试用期状态。
隐藏文件清理
同时需要清理~/Library/Application Support/PremiumSoft CyberTech/Navicat CC/Navicat Premium/目录下的所有以.开头的隐藏文件,这些文件通常包含加密的验证信息。
🛠️ 三种重置方案对比分析
方案一:标准重置脚本
- 适用场景:日常使用,保留个人配置
- 操作方式:双击
reset_navicat.command或执行./reset_navicat.sh - 优点:精准删除验证数据,不影响其他设置
方案二:自动重置功能
- 适用场景:频繁使用,希望自动化操作
- 操作方式:双击
auto_reset_navicat.command - 注意事项:脚本位置改变时需要重新运行
方案三:完全卸载重装
- 适用场景:重置脚本无效时的终极方案
- 操作命令:
sudo sh delete_navicat.sh
📋 详细操作步骤指南
准备工作
- 数据备份:依次点击
文件-导出链接-全选-导出密码导出并备份所有数据 - 关闭软件:确保Navicat Premium完全退出
- 权限检查:确保有足够的系统权限执行脚本
重置执行流程
- 下载安装:从Navicat官网下载最新版本并安装
- 试用体验:选择试用14天,正常使用到期
- 运行脚本:根据需要选择合适的重置方案
- 验证效果:重新启动Navicat Premium查看试用期状态
图:Navicat配置文件中的关键验证字段
⚠️ 常见问题与解决方案
重置不生效怎么办?
- 完全退出软件:确保Navicat Premium进程完全关闭
- 重启系统:执行系统重启后再运行重置脚本
- 检查文件删除:按照原理说明验证对应的数据是否成功删除
脚本执行权限问题
- 首次执行可能需要授予执行权限:
chmod +x reset_navicat.sh - 部分系统需要终端权限:在系统偏好设置-安全性与隐私中允许
图:Navicat配置目录中的隐藏验证文件
🔧 技术细节说明
文件路径说明
- 配置文件:
~/Library/Preferences/com.navicat.NavicatPremium.plis - 隐藏文件目录:
~/Library/Application Support/PremiumSoft CyberTech/Navicat CC/Navicat Premium/
验证字段识别
在配置文件中查找符合32位哈希格式的顶级键,例如:
91F6C435D172C8163E0689D3DAD3F3E9B966DBD409B87EF577C9BBF3363E9614014BF4EC24C114BEF46E1587042B3619
📝 使用注意事项
重要提醒
- 商业用途:请购买正版授权支持开发者
- 数据安全:重置前务必完成数据备份
- 版本兼容:支持最新版Navicat Premium
- 语言支持:支持英文版和中文版
最佳实践
- 定期备份数据库连接信息
- 关注项目更新,及时获取最新重置方案
- 重大版本更新后可能需要调整重置策略
💡 进阶技巧
脚本自定义
对于有经验的用户,可以查看reset_navicat_old.sh文件了解详细实现原理,根据需要进行个性化调整。
自动化部署
如果需要频繁重置,可以考虑将自动重置脚本添加到系统启动项,实现完全自动化管理。
通过掌握这些重置技巧,你可以持续享受Navicat Premium带来的专业数据库管理体验。记住,对于长期使用需求,购买正版授权始终是最佳选择。
【免费下载链接】navicat_reset_macnavicat16 mac版无限重置试用期脚本项目地址: https://gitcode.com/gh_mirrors/na/navicat_reset_mac
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考